Ebonyi State Governor, Francis Nwifuru, on Monday sent forth the second batch of beneficiaries of the state government’s scholarship scheme, as they pursue postgraduate studies in the United Kingdom.

In a statement issued on Monday by the Special Assistant to the Governor on New Media, Leo Oketa, the state government said the inauguration of the second batch marked “another historic milestone in the educational advancement of Ebonyi State.”

The governor offered prayers at the Chuba Okadigbo International and Cargo Airport, Ezza, during the formal inauguration of 98 Ebonyians selected under the second phase of the programme.

Addressing the scholars, Nwifuru described them as his children and charged them to excel academically and return home to contribute meaningfully to the development of Ebonyi State.

“As a father, I release you today with love and prayer.

“As your governor, I send you forth with confidence and hope. I pray God to guide you on your journey, protect you in a foreign land, grant you excellence in your study, and bring you back home safely and triumphantly,” the governor said.

He urged the beneficiaries to justify the confidence reposed in them by the state.

The governor explained that the scholarship initiative was born out of his personal experience and commitment to inclusive leadership.

“I made a solemn decision of giving you what I did not have.

“The opportunity I missed, I will create for others. Where my journey was rough, yours should be smoother. That is the true meaning of leadership and the true essence of fatherhood,” Nwifuru said.

Oketa also said the 98 beneficiaries comprise the second batch of the state’s overseas scholarship programme, with 92 scholars scheduled to depart in batches within the week, while six will travel in September in line with the commencement of their academic programmes.

“This development builds upon the initiative launched just over a year ago by His Excellency, Rt. Hon. Francis Ogbonna Nwifuru, who sponsored 204 Ebonyians to pursue Master’s and PhD programmes in the United Kingdom,” the statement said.

Oketa noted that the investment has already yielded positive results.

“Many of the first batch of Master’s degree beneficiaries completed their programmes with distinctions and academic excellence,” he said.

The statement added that the scholarship package covers tuition, accommodation and living allowances, a structure designed to ensure beneficiaries “excel without distraction.”

“This initiative is not a one-off intervention but a structured roadmap for building a knowledgeable, competitive and globally attuned Ebonyi State,” the statement said.

The state government reiterated that the programme reflects a long-term strategy to strengthen human capital and position Ebonyi State for sustainable socio-economic development.
